The Press: Rough Ride

As many a victim of U.S. press conferences knows, being interviewed by the press is sometimes a good deal like being third-degreed by the cops. John William Bricker caught it last week from the Washington press corps.

Sixty strong, they pushed into the Ohio Governor's small suite in the Mayflower Hotel. Here, after all the humdrum bureau interviews, was fair game: a real, live presidential candidate on a self-built bandwagon. The pink-cheeked candidate looked as if he expected a rough ride. He got one.
